Family Bible Study

A lot of people think that Bible Sunday school is enough for their kids to learn all about the word of God. Although Bible Sunday school is important, it is not the whole story. The most important activity, in fact, is family Bible study. You see, the church is a community, and the family is a community within the community. Unless you study the Bible with your children, you will not be able to nurture that community. Your kids respect you, so they must know that the love of God is in your heart for it to find its place in theirs.

Of course, children Bible study is not as easy as you might think. It is easy to give them some familiarity with the stories, but to tell them in a way that is appropriate for kids and does not distort the word of God is a little bit difficult sometimes. You see, children are naturally curious. Family Bible study has to address the curiosity and answer all the questions in a meaningful way that they will understand. That is the only way that they can get a head start on mastering the truths of the Bible.

Bible study resources can be a great addition to your normal practice of reading the Bible to your kids. Family Bible study, of course, starts with the book itself, but it goes beyond it. You need to get your kids to start thinking about the Bible, to incorporate into their everyday life. Your family Bible study can be complemented by the things that kids like – games, puppets, songs and stories. Telling kids parables is also an excellent way to enrich the family Bible studies. Parables can teach them right and wrong and help to integrate the morals of the Bible it into their lives. If your kids can learn early on how practical and useful the Bible is, they'll never turn from it.

If you are not sure how to go about setting up a family Bible study program, you can always consult the teacher at your child's Sunday school. Don't be afraid to ask questions when you're doing family Bible study. After all, just because you know how to be a good parent does not mean you know how to be a good teacher. Teaching is a whole different set of skills, and if you don't possess them, you have to find a way to learn it one way or another.
